here are some observations I made during last weeks stay at BCV
The Bad
1) The motion sensitive AC control makes for a nice warm room when you return from the parks...it also makes it quite warm during the evening hours.
2) Illuminations could actually pass as a bomb going off....espescially on the side that faces the swan and the dolphin, you get all of the noise and none of the show.
3) I dont know if any one else had this experience, but when you sit in the living room chair (not the couch) it takes about 20 seconds for the air to drain out of it so you can actually get comfortable....but when you stand up all the air rushes back in so you have to repeat the process any time you sit down
The Good
1) Man is this place gorgeous....the pool was wonderful, and truly quiet. The location is second to none.
2) The view from the fifth floor studio we had for one night room 559 was outstanding....spaceship earth was right in front of us, and illuminations was clearly visible.....only drawback to this room is the incessant noise from passing cars below at night.
3) If you want to know where the best views are, simply drive by on the road leading into BCV and look up at the fifth floor rooms facing out to the road....that is where you want to be.
4) Storm along bay is exceptional....this pool is simply the best, it has the best atmosphere in my opinion, and the waterslide is a definite thrill...this all of course is dependent on the size of the crowd....everyone was being checked on the way in, and everyone was given a wrist band, we where able to get a table with an umbrella both days we where at the pool.
5) Valet parking is great, but let me tell you if you park your car in the rgular lot there is an entrance not 20 yards away into the BCV, and an elevator right there....if you where to check in, leave your bags in the car and then go park, you would have little trouble lugging them to your room.
6) We had a two bedroom for six nights on the fifth floor facing the swan and the dolphin....is it just me or is there any one else who thinks this is one of the best views around...for some reason the swan and the dolphin are the things that I first envision in my mind when thinking about disney on a winter day...strange i know.
